Ensuring freedom of the media, a complication of the economic situation, the increase in suicides, and corruption and bribery are the leading topics of today's press.
The Azerbaijan newspaper writes about the appreciation of the freedom of media in Azerbaijan by foreign media. The development of independent media is one of the priorities of the government.
The article comments on the V World Congress of News Agencies and XXII Information Council of State Agencies of the CIS Countries held in Baku. In Azerbaijan, according to official figures, there are more than 40 daily and more than 20 weekly and monthly newspapers, as well as 10 national, one satellite and 17 cable TV channels, and more than 75% of the population uses the Internet.

Echo has published an article about the increase in the number of suicides among minors. The Ministry of Education should create a service of individual psychological assistance to educational institutions. This requires psychologists who are not available.
The reasons for suicide may be different, but the most important one is depression. Students are the most vulnerable group. In Azerbaijan, there is no aid to potential suicides.
Novoye Vremya publishes an article on the subsistence level, which will be increased by a meager amount of 18 manat - to 155 manat per month.
In determining the minimum amount state officials lose touch with reality, for it is impossible not only to live but to survive on this money.
Bizim Yol writes about the report of Transparency International on the level of corruption in the world, including Azerbaijan. The author provides detailed information on the assessment of the level of corruption in Azerbaijan, as well as about the survey on the situation. There is a tendency to reduce the level of bribery, which is associated with the emergence of ASAN Service.
